Martin Keown slammed Kyle Walker for 'losing his head' after the Manchester City was sent off for a petulant challenge as the Premier League champions lost 2-1 to RB Leipzig.
The England international received his marching orders three minutes from time, as he needlessly took a swipe at the Portuguese's left leg.
While City topped the Group A despite losing in Germany, Walker's sending off means the right-back will miss the first leg of the Round of 16 in February.
